Dynamic Supply Chains Powered by Real-Time AI Insights.

Adaptive supply chain models use AI to optimize supply chain operations by analyzing real-time data from suppliers, logistics providers, and market trends. These models enable automotive manufacturers to adjust their supply chain strategies dynamically to account for fluctuations in market demand, unforeseen disruptions, and operational needs. This approach helps companies improve the reliability of part deliveries, reduce costs, and maintain production schedules.

How to Do It?

  1. Integrate AI platforms with existing supply chain management systems to collect and analyze data from various sources, including suppliers and logistics providers.
  2. Use machine learning algorithms to identify patterns and predict disruptions or demand spikes.
  3. Implement automated decision-making tools that can adjust orders, routes, and inventory levels based on real-time insights.
  4. Continuously refine AI models using new data to enhance the accuracy of predictions and adaptability.

Benefits:

  • Improves supply chain flexibility and resilience to disruptions.
  • Reduces lead times and enhances on-time deliveries.
  • Optimizes inventory levels, preventing overstock and stockouts.
  • Increases operational efficiency and cost savings.

Risks and Pitfalls:

  • Dependence on accurate data for reliable AI model performance.
  • Potential cybersecurity risks from the integration of supply chain systems with external data sources.
  • High initial setup and integration costs.

Example:

Nissan’s AI-Powered Supply Chain Management
Nissan employs AI technology to manage supply chain disruptions, ensuring timely delivery of parts to its assembly plants. The AI system analyzes data from suppliers and logistics partners, as well as market conditions, to predict potential bottlenecks and plan alternative routes or sourcing strategies. This proactive approach has helped Nissan reduce the impact of global supply chain disruptions, maintain production continuity, and deliver vehicles on schedule.
